This is a casual suggestion for a rule that I don't think can be automatically enforced and probably won't need to be unless someone's being malicious about it. Perhaps limit how many topics a person can have on page 1 of a forum section (e.g. tech news) at a time. With each page only being 20 posts, even 3 posts is 15% of the total posts on that page and I've intentionally limited myself to that before because I didn't want to be overwhelming or annoying. I feel like this would help prevent people from dominating a specific category.

Unfortunately, this would be a bit of Moderator overreach, and a paid position would be out of the question. We would have to rely on a current or future LMG employee position to do that rather than from the moderation team which is made up of all volunters doing this on our own personal time. Regardless, the spirit of TN is more of a reporting the current issues that have been reported on so we can discuss and comment on amongst the community, not creating news that has yet to make it mainstream; doing so would place the "news" item into a kind of speculation, rumor sort of place.

 

On second thought, we don't want to take away from LTT Labs in any way by generating news not yet reported on in the mainstream as we can in a Sidways way become a independent news source and that would effectively change the spirit of the TN section. <- IMO.
